Airbus Acj Twotwenty vs Airbus Acj319 vs Boeing Bbj Max 7 vs Boeing Bbj Max 8 vs Gulfstream G750
The Airbus ACJ TwoTwenty sits between large-cabin business jets and airliner-derived VIP transports: it offers intercontinental capability at roughly 5,600 nautical miles and typically accommodates about 18–50 passengers depending on layout. The Airbus ACJ320 is a larger VIP airliner platform with long-range performance around 4,200–4,700 nautical miles and usually higher capacity, often configured for roughly 25–80 passengers. Boeing’s BBJ MAX 7 and BBJ MAX 8 are also VIP airliner-derived aircraft. The BBJ MAX 7 generally emphasizes range, reaching about 7,000 nautical miles with typical VIP capacities around 25–50 passengers, while the BBJ MAX 8 trades some range for size, coming in around 6,300–6,500 nautical miles and commonly accommodating about 30–80 passengers in VIP configurations. The Gulfstream G750 is a purpose-built ultra-long-range business jet rather than an airliner derivative, optimized for fewer passengers and premium cabin comfort. It delivers about 7,500 nautical miles of range and typically carries around 12–19 passengers.
